Product Details: Ultrasound systems use ultrasonic waves to measure or acquire images of soft tissue or blood flow. They consist of a probe with piezoelectric elements that generate ultrasonic wave beams.

Frequently Asked Questions (FAQs)
What are the key features to look for in an ultrasound machine from a manufacturer?
When choosing an ultrasound machine, consider image quality, portability, ease of use, and the range of available probes. Additionally, check for features like advanced imaging technologies, user-friendly interfaces, and compatibility with other medical systems.
How do I choose a reliable ultrasound machine manufacturer?
Look for manufacturers with a strong reputation, positive customer reviews, and a history of innovation. It’s also helpful to consider their customer support, warranty options, and the availability of training for your staff.
What is the typical production process for ultrasound machines?
The production process usually involves design and engineering, sourcing high-quality components, assembly, rigorous testing for quality assurance, and compliance with medical regulations. Each step ensures that the final product meets safety and performance standards.
Are there any certifications I should look for in ultrasound machine manufacturers?
Yes, ensure the manufacturer complies with international standards such as ISO 13485 for medical devices and has FDA approval if you’re in the U.S. These certifications indicate that the manufacturer adheres to quality management systems and safety regulations.
What kind of support can I expect from ultrasound machine manufacturers after purchase?
Most manufacturers offer technical support, maintenance services, and training for your staff. They may also provide software updates and assistance with troubleshooting to ensure your machine operates efficiently throughout its lifespan.
